Q: Is 34,215,447 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 34,215,447 is a composite number.

Why is 34,215,447 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 34,215,447 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 19 21 29 57 87 133 203 399 551 609 1,653 2,957 3,857 8,871 11,571 20,699 56,183 62,097 85,753 168,549 257,259 393,281 600,271 1,179,843 1,629,307 1,800,813 4,887,921 11,405,149 and 34,215,447, with no remainder.

Since 34,215,447 cannot be divided by just 1 and 34,215,447, it is a composite number.
